Description
This contract award is for life insurance services for Locally Employed Staff (LES) – Mission Brazil.
The total price for the base period (May 1, 2025, to April 30, 2026) is BRL 358,416.14.
The total contract value, including the base year and all option years, is BRL 1,902,879.97.
The contract has been awarded to: Sul América Seguros de Pessoas e Previdência S.A.
The selection was made in full compliance with the evaluation criteria outlined in the solicitation.
